Ask us anythingFor guided tours you ride as part of a group led by a licensed local guide. We strongly recommend having riding experience, and for legal riding in Vietnam an International Driving Permit with a motorcycle category is advised. If you're a beginner, our Mini Bike Tour on easy semi-automatic bikes is the perfect place to start.
